Lasham, Booker, Dunstable, Redhill, Parham, Ringmere, Challock, North
Weald. What sort of gliding do you want to do, and how big and
professional do you want the club to be?

No longer at North Weald. We (Essex GC) had that site from 1961, and
Ridgewell too since 1991, but finally left North Weald 1-2 years ago
as a gliding site and now are all at Ridgewell.

There may be motor gliders there, but not easy to get a ride in one
for a visitor, I suspect.
